About Audi
Audi AG traces its roots to 1909 and the Auto Union heritage that later formed the modern four-ring brand. Headquartered in Ingolstadt, Audi builds premium cars and SUVs with a strong motorsport and Quattro reputation, and is a core Volkswagen Group marque alongside a push into electric models such as the e-tron family.

Brand timeline
- 1909August Horch founds the company that becomes Audi
- 1932Auto Union formed with the four-ring emblem
- 1965Modern Audi revival under Volkswagen ownership begins
- 1980Quattro all-wheel drive becomes a defining technology
- TodayGlobal premium brand with accelerating EV portfolio
